
基于STM32单片机的超声波测距与倒车雷达提醒报警系统的Proteus仿真(含源码、原理图及论文).zip
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本资源提供一个基于STM32单片机设计的超声波测距系统,实现倒车雷达功能,并具备障碍物提醒报警。内附Proteus仿真文件、完整源代码和电路原理图以及相关技术论文。
该资源包包含了一个基于STM32单片机的超声波测距倒车雷达系统的完整实现方案,涵盖了从硬件设计到软件编程以及仿真验证的所有过程。此系统的主要目标是为车辆提供安全的倒车辅助功能,通过使用超声波传感器测量与障碍物的距离,并在显示器上显示结果;当距离过近时会触发报警装置以提醒驾驶员注意安全。
STM32是由STMicroelectronics公司推出的一款基于ARM Cortex-M内核的微控制器系列。它因其高性能、低功耗和丰富的外设接口而广受欢迎。在这个项目中,STM32作为主控单元负责接收并处理超声波传感器的数据,并控制显示设备与报警系统。
该系统的测距原理是利用超声波发射器发出特定频率的脉冲信号,在遇到障碍物后反射回接收端的时间差来计算距离信息。通过分析原理图可以了解硬件连接方式,包括STM32与超声波传感器、显示屏和报警模块之间的接口设计;这有助于理解各组件如何协同工作及电源管理等细节。
源代码部分通常包含用于配置GPIO、定时器等功能的C或C++程序,并实现超声波测距算法以及与其他设备通信的功能。通过分析这些代码,开发人员可以学习到STM32 HAL库或LL库的应用方法及嵌入式系统中信号处理和实时操作系统的基本概念。
Proteus仿真工具支持数字与模拟电路混合仿真的特性在此项目中有广泛应用;它有助于设计者在硬件焊接前验证设计方案的正确性、检查信号路径并预测整个系统的功能表现。此外,论文部分可能包括了系统的设计理念、工作原理、实现过程及测试结果等内容,是整个项目的总结报告。
该资源包为学习嵌入式开发技术、单片机应用知识以及汽车安全设计提供了完整的案例参考;通过研究此项目可掌握STM32的开发技能与超声波测距技术,并了解实际产品开发流程和方法。
全部评论 (0)


